Twelve executives to receive 2014 Multicultural TV Leadership Awards

Maribel Ramos-Weiner| 13 de diciembre de 2013

Hernán López, president and CEO, FOX International Channels is one of the winners of the Programmer Management Executive category

Broadcasting & Cable and Multichannel News have announced the 12 winners of the Multicultural TV Leadership Awards, which will be presented at a luncheon ceremony during the Multicultural TV Summit on Tuesday, February 4, 2014 at the Grand Hyatt in New York City. The Awards recognize business executives who have contributed to the sustainable growth of multicultural TV—defined as video intended for an audience segment of a specific ethnicity, nationality, region, gender, religious affiliation or LGBT lifestyle.The selection process was based on the collective scores submitted by ten judges that represent a wide spectrum of the multicultural communities: ethnic, national, region, religious affiliation, gender and LGBT.“Some of the judges are noteworthy celebrities, others are experts in their fields. The judges allowed for an impartial, non-political and knowledgeable assessment of each candidate. By using an impartial panel of judges, our intent is to award the most legitimate honor on our recipients. We often hear that such awards are politically motivated. In the case of the Multicultural TV Leadership Awards the recipients are being acknowledged because they deserve it,” said to PRODU, Joe Schramm, managing partner of Schramm Marketing Group, Inc.Following are the 12 winners by category:Programmer Management Executive: Hernán López, president and CEO, FOX International Channels, and Michael Schwimmer, CEO, NUVOtv, who shared the identical scoreAgency Management Executive: Esther Franklin, EVP, Head of SMG Americas Strategy, Starcom MediaVest GroupPay TV Management Executive: David Rone, president, Sports, News and Local Programming, Time Warner CableConsumer Marketing Executive (Programmer): Vicky Free, EVP & Chief Marketing Officer, BET NetworksConsumer Marketing Executive (Provider): Alessandra Otero-Reiss, VP, Relationship Marketing, Time Warner CableAdvertising Sales Executive: Mike Rosen, EVP of Advertising Sales, Telemundo MediaMedia Planning Executive: Silvia García, VP of Media Planning and Multiplatform Strategy, Univision Communications Inc.Account Management Executive: Cesar Sroka, Group Account Director, OMD Multicultural, OMDProgramming Distribution Executive: Timothy Boell, SVP Content Distribution & Marketing, Asia TV USA Ltd.Programming Acquisition Executive: Freddy Rolón, VP, Deportes Programming & Business Units, ESPNAudience Development/Tune-in Promotions Executive: Kim Bondy, senior executive producer, America Tonight, Al Jazeera America.
